8-K: Reddit Announces Q1 2025 Results: Revenue Surges 61% to $392.4 Million, Achieving GAAP Profitability
Earnings Release
Reddit reports strong Q1 2025 results with significant revenue growth, GAAP profitability, and increased user engagement.
Summary
- Reddit announced its Q1 2025 financial results, showcasing substantial growth and profitability.
- Total revenue increased by 61% year-over-year to $392.4 million.
- Ad revenue also grew by 61% year-over-year, reaching $358.6 million.
- The company achieved GAAP profitability with a net income of $26.2 million, representing 6.7% of revenue.
- Adjusted EBITDA was $115.3 million, or 29.4% of revenue, a significant improvement from the prior year.
- Daily Active Uniques (DAUq) increased by 31% year-over-year to 108.1 million.
- Weekly Active Uniques (WAUq) also increased by 31% year-over-year to 401.3 million.
- For Q2 2025, Reddit estimates revenue in the range of $410 million to $430 million and Adjusted EBITDA in the range of $110 million to $130 million.

Positives
- Significant revenue growth of 61% year-over-year.
- Achievement of GAAP profitability with a net income of $26.2 million.
- Substantial improvement in Adjusted EBITDA to $115.3 million.
- Strong growth in Daily Active Uniques (DAUq) and Weekly Active Uniques (WAUq).
- Increase in gross margin to 90.5%.
- Operating cash flow improved to $127.6 million.
- Free cash flow improved to $126.6 million.
- International revenue growth driven by machine translation and focus markets.

Comparison to Industry Standards
- Reddit's revenue growth of 61% year-over-year is strong compared to other social media companies.
- Meta's revenue grew 27% year-over-year in Q1 2024.
- Snap's revenue grew 21% year-over-year in Q1 2024.
- Reddit's gross margin of 90.5% is also high compared to other social media companies.
- Meta's gross margin was 80.7% in Q1 2024.
- Snap's gross margin was 65% in Q1 2024.
